Top 5 Business Marketing Lessons from Successful Entrepreneurs

As an entrepreneur, there are a lot of things you can learn from successful business leaders. One of the most important areas where you can glean knowledge from these leaders is in marketing. Here are the top 5 business marketing lessons from successful entrepreneurs:

Lesson 1: Know Your Target Audience

Successful entrepreneurs know their target audience inside and out. They understand their customers’ needs, preferences and behaviors. They research their target audience and use that information to create targeted marketing campaigns that resonate with them. For example, Apple knows that their target audience consists of tech-savvy individuals who are willing to pay a premium for quality products. As a result, Apple’s marketing campaigns focus on the quality, design and innovation of their products.

Lesson 2: Focus on Unique Value Proposition (UVP)

Successful entrepreneurs understand the importance of having a unique value proposition (UVP). Your UVP is the unique benefit that sets you apart from your competitors. If you don’t have a UVP, you’re just another business in a crowded market. For example, Amazon’s UVP is offering customers unlimited products with quick and reliable delivery. Their marketing campaigns focus on their vast selection, competitive pricing, convenience and ease of use.

Lesson 3: Emphasize the Benefits, Not the Features

Successful entrepreneurs understand that their customers care more about the benefits of their product or service than its features. Benefits are what customers get from using your product while features are what your product does. For example, McDonald’s advertisements focus on the taste and convenience of their food, rather than the ingredients used.

Lesson 4: Use Social Media Effectively

Successful entrepreneurs understand the power of social media. They know that social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ter and Instagram can help them connect with their target audience and build relationships. As a result, they use social media platforms effectively to market their products and services. For example, Kylie Jenner, a successful entrepreneur and owner of Kylie Cosmetics, markets her makeup line to her audience through Instagram and Snapchat.

Lesson 5: Monitor Your Results and Optimize Your Marketing Strategy

Successful entrepreneurs understand the importance of monitoring their marketing campaigns and optimizing their strategies. They analyze their marketing data and adjust their strategies to improve their results. For example, Tesla noticed that most of their referrals were coming from social media, so they invested more in social media advertising.

In conclusion, as a business owner, it’s important to learn from successful entrepreneurs and their marketing tactics. By knowing your target audience, focusing on your unique value proposition, emphasizing the benefits, using social media effectively, and optimizing your marketing strategy, you’ll be on your way to success.
